- This story has Dallas ties – After ‘whites only’ job posting, Va. tech company hit with fine from the Justice Department
- The job posting by Ashburn-based Arthur Grand Technologies Inc. was published in March 2023 and said that the company was only looking for “U.S. Born Citizens [white] who are local within 60 miles from Dallas, TX [Don’t share with candidates],” according to a Justice Department news release.
- Proposed Texas GOP platform calls for the Bible in schools
- Republican Party of Texas delegates voted on a platform calling for new laws to require the Bible to be taught in public schools and a constitutional amendment requiring statewide elected leaders to win the popular vote in a majority of Texas counties.
